Infrastructure Engineer

American Family Mutual Insurance Company
paid time off, paid holidays, 401(k)
United States, Boston
June 06, 2023
Reporting to the Technology Services Manager, this high level individual contributor will work collaboratively with Software Engineers to analyze, develop, implement, support, and continuously evolve software-defined infrastructure, application patterns, software, and technology solutions in Cloud environments to govern, monitor, and secure the cloud environments and data for the company. You will build repeatable solutions working within and between engineering and operations teams to identify and implement process improvements. Looking for 5+ years with demonstrated proficiency and experience across a broad range of cloud services. Cloud service experience in Azure, AWS, and GPC are preferred but not required. Compensation Minimum:$90,200 /year Compensation Maximum:$144,500 /year

Compensation may vary based on the job level and your geographic work location.

Specialized Knowledge and Skills Requirements

  • Extensive knowledge and understanding of infrastructure technologies
  • Solid knowledge and understanding of multiple infrastructure and non-infrastructure IT areas (e.g. development, configuration, deployment, etc.)
  • Demonstrated experience developing & testing code (applications, scripts, etc.)
  • Solid knowledge and understanding of one or more of the following focus areas:

    Computing platform technologies - Public and private cloud infrastructure design, virtualization technologies, server platforms such as Linux and Windows, storage systems, desktop technologies, etc.

    Database and Middleware technologies - DBMS platforms such as Oracle, DB2, SQL Server, web infrastructure platforms such as JBoss EAP and IIS, software engineering and SOA.

    Network and Communications technologies - IP networking, carrier services, telephony and customer contact management solutions, communication and collaboration technologies such as email messaging, text messaging, desktop sharing, social networking solutions and services.
